SKW Urban Abacus



Join Deb to explore how fun and easy the Sew Kind of Wonderful (SKW) Quick Curve Ruler can make sewing curves! This class is appropriate for confident beginners. Make curved pieces with no pins, no matching centers - just cut, sew and square up! We will work on a wall hanging (18.5" x 22.5") in the class and materials listed are those needed to complete only this piece - see the pattern for a full list of the materials needed to complete a throw sized quilt. Once you take this class, you will have the skills you need to complete the throw (and you'll be hooked on using your QCR!).
Deb is a certified Sew Kind of Wonderful instructor


Skill Level: Beginner
Skill Details: Students should be able to use a rotary cutter confidently
Requirements: Fabric Requirements: (4) fat 1/8 assorted prints - or (4) 10" layer cake squares (1) fat 1/8 sashing strips ("beading string") 1/4 yard (not fat quarter) background fabric Quick Curve Ruler Pattern - Urban Abacus by SKW Sewing Machine in good working order 1/4" foot for sewing machine - the kind without a "guard" works best Rotary Cutter - 45 mm with a good blade 8 1/2" or larger square ruler Thread for piecing (I like Aurfil in a medium/light gray) Basic sewing supplies - pins, scissors, seam ripper, (stiletto is handy if you have it)
